About 19 Alma Street
19 Alma Street is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Haworth, Keighley, Keighley (BD22 8HN). It has a recorded floor area of 85 m² (around 915 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(October 2022)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band. When first surveyed in June 2014 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Good,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and window efficiency went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 84). Other recorded features include notable views.
On energy efficiency it sits in the top 10% of properties in this postcode. Across 2003–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.3%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£191/sq ft) was about 75.4%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£175,000 in December 2022.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
